Fort Cavazos Landing Strip 22 (US-6502), also known as Longhorn Auxiliary Landing Strip (22XS), is a military (Army) private-use landing strip located within Fort Cavazos (formerly Fort Hood), Texas. Due to its designation as a private military facility, there are no publicly available traveler reviews or experiences in the traditional sense, such as those found for commercial airports. Information regarding terminal facilities, amenities, security wait times for public travelers, or customs/immigration experiences is not applicable or publicly documented for this landing strip.
In summary, Fort Cavazos Landing Strip 22 (US-6502) is a specialized military asset not open to public commercial travel, and therefore, conventional traveler reviews and experiences are unavailable. Any interaction with the area would be strictly governed by the access and security protocols of Fort Cavazos.
